Minecraft Horse Breeding Guide: Steps to Create Foals and Mules

10 Jul 2024

Before you can even think about breeding a horse, you need to have two tamed horses of your own. For the most part, horses are primarily located in the Savana or Plains biomes of Minecraft, but you can find them elsewhere, such as in villages, as well. To tame a horse, all you have to do is attempt to ride one over and over. You can do this by right-clicking on a mouse or pressing left trigger on a controller.

Your first several attempts to mount the horse will likely result in you being thrown off. However, keep persisting and eventually the horse will take to you, resulting in them being tamed. You’ll know when the horse is tamed when hearts appear on the screen. Repeat the taming process on two separate horses and ensure the two horses are near each other so they can breed. Ideally, you’ll build a fenced-in pen at your base for the horses with enough room for a small horse to roam, as well.

Feeding and Breeding

Once the two tamed horses are near each other, you need to feed them either Golden Apples or Golden Carrots. Both of these food items can be looted in chests across Minecraft, but you can also craft them. Crafting a Golden Apple is accomplished by surrounding a regular apple with gold ingots at a crafting table while a Golden Carrot is crafted by surrounding a regular carrot with gold nuggets.

With two Golden Apples or Golden Carrots in your inventory, feed one to each tamed horse. Ensure the horses are near each other and both eat the food item you give them. If you’ve done everything correctly, then a baby foal will spawn near the two horses within mere seconds. The foal follows its parents for roughly 20 in-game minutes, at which point it matures into a fully grown horse.

Breeding for Better Stats

Breeding horses in Minecraft is the best way to spawn horses of different colors and stats. However, you can also breed other mobs with horses. For example, you can breed a horse and donkey together to make a mule. This requires the same process as breeding two horses. Whatever baby mob you breed, its stats will depend on the stats of its parents. So if you want to breed a near-perfect baby foal or mule, you need to ensure their parents’ stats are high. Unfortunately, it’s highly unlikely you’ll be able to breed a foal or mule with perfect stats, so getting close to perfect should be considered good enough.

How to make flag patterns in minecraft?

To create flag patterns in Minecraft, you'll need a Loom block, dyes, and a Banner. Place the Loom block and right-click on it to open the Loom interface. Place the Banner in the top left slot and the Dye in the slot next to it. You'll see a variety of pattern options to choose from. Select the desired pattern, then take the patterned Banner from the right slot. You can layer multiple patterns by repeating the process with different dyes.

How to add servers on minecraft xbox bedrock edition 2023?

To add servers on Minecraft Xbox Bedrock Edition 2023, follow these steps: 1. Launch Minecraft and go to the main menu. 2. Select 'Play,' then go to the 'Servers' tab. 3. Scroll down and select 'Add Server.' 4. Enter the server name, IP address, and port. 5. Click 'Save' to add the server to your list. You can now join the server by selecting it from your server list. Note that some servers might require additional steps such as registration or whitelisting.
